Resumo

Abstract The catalytic activities of various copper(I) clusters in the oxidation of 2,6‐dimethylphenol (XOH) in pyridine and the preparative oxidative polymerization of XOH with these complexes were investigated. It was found that the copper(I) cluster containing 1,2‐dicyano‐1,2‐ethenedithiolate ligands is more effective in the oxidative polymerization of XOH than the complex containing isomeric ligands. The electric conductivities of these Cu(I) complexes are small.
